砍敺 IT_man 2017-3-21 22:08 蝺刻摩
0 \+ l: S$ q& m* l
" t. O- {% I. d : http://linux.vbird.org/linux_basic/0230filesystem.php#parted http://blog.yam.com/wesley1981/article/16596463 賊隞 fstab, findfs, mount blkid% W7 B G5 V' r5 \8 x5 |
fdisk 隢 :http://blogger.gtwang.org/2012/02/linux.html
9 E5 m5 v2 o- K- M8 `% Hformat 憭扳 16TB 蝖祉(>16TB銝摰閬冽迨隞) : http://www.unix-ninja.com/p/Formatting_Ext4_volumes_beyond_the_16TB_limit/http://blog.yourdream.cc/2014/11/19/morethan16t.html% M& q# q% ? Z' l: X8 L
# H8 H2 D# D: p5 _* M( u2 h
啣蝖祉,璈芸mount(銝隞孑ount芣舀急,璈銝芸mount) :/etc/fstab 乩銝銵:( l+ n# Z8 A! L5 W% V2 V$ s/ L
/dev/sdb1 /home2 ext4 defaults 1 1
7 u( A- t. J1 Z# s5 h" ?! Y$ k. Z- B' w6 N
parted 閰喟敦隞:https://blog.gtwang.org/linux/pa ... -disk-partitions/2/) ~. G4 k( h5 c' E' B( e' e
$ X6 _/ D0 K5 l! Jfdisk 隞文芣舀 MBR 銝舀 GPT ,閬 GPT蝖祉雿輻 parted 游隞文脩′蝣,隞乩撠隞蝝 parted冽
( G4 N& X, Z9 a! a |9 X; w4 y; ]8 N3 l# U6 ]8 n$ [( e2 d
4 V1 y ?2 G+ q5 K" Oparted 臭誑湔亙其銵隞文撠勗莎臭撣詨末函隞歹摰撣貊函隤瘜憒銝嚗" q, q1 D4 A2 V
6 Z8 N$ n% e7 l9 c4 L6 B7 K g$ qparted [鋆蝵孫 [隞 [窟]
4 z2 i" \5 N8 j3 p/ q$ ^) N賊賂% J. O# r8 k$ c/ T
隞文踝( F) b/ D" R; R1 @4 G \+ W- j
啣莎mkpart [primary|logical|extended] [ext4|vfat|xfs] 憪 蝯
! O3 Q2 n" y. w3 M2 K$ Y6 B 憿舐內莎print% j* F# T- a1 Z" {! g/ S- k- R
芷文莎rm [partition]- g1 N* n N% A, l5 A O8 p7 y* H8 a
靘憒:
: W$ [& O- q& t t# K* D
. Y: ]3 q- x& {% l寞銝:. c2 W* z0 D7 D. e/ f: |2 r' P
(parted) mkpart primary 0 100% (primary皰artition name)
* {9 N% p- {* n" O& n
" G' i+ d" @, i- \寞鈭:
7 \: j7 ^- ^4 A& s9 V8 SPartition name? []? 30T_part/ k: e- j z+ I% W8 |
File system type? [ext2]? ext2 (ext4銝霅血)7 w4 x' _8 M3 k) `5 ]
Start? 0B or 0%. w9 ^+ y" y0 v% U9 s
End? 30TB or 100%2 t# g$ w B2 j' I. b
Warning: You requested a partition from 0.00B to 30.0TB.! G; h% Y& C0 X0 Y/ f" T4 S7 `
The closest location we can manage is 17.4kB to 30.0TB.
- E3 J7 j( D& c9 m6 QIs this still acceptable to you?
5 l$ k: p0 b8 fYes/No? Yes5 v! Y1 Y1 K) K" T
Warning: The resulting partition is not properly aligned for best performance.
2 s% j. a1 R( l1 s; PIgnore/Cancel?1 B! s8 l# c) N) b$ @- G, D
雿輻牠xt2撠曹銝餈啗郎; i0 g# r6 h8 C& B6 @; v, W; k
mkfs -t ext4 /dev/sdb1 ===> format
6 ^! A0 k# O, n% C- @* U i; A4 [ERROR:
9 ?+ o ^* P% F0 Emkfs.ext4: Size of device /dev/sdb1 too big to be expressed in 32 bits1 ]. i$ d8 F1 A
using a blocksize of 4096
9 N6 p3 \. I# x6 gSOL: + Z- a$ z. F, Y" y
format > 16TB see https://www.unix-ninja.com/p/For ... yond_the_16TB_limit8 a9 j5 [2 `5 e% z4 n. o% j
/usr/local/src/wget -Oe2fsprogs-1.42.7.tar.gz http://downloads.sourceforge.net ... _mirror=superb-dca3! u; U; E+ Z# R/ y! Z8 D C, d
/usr/local/src/tar -zxvf e2fsprogs-1.42.7.tar.gz5 }7 D0 A8 L: M) K+ Q5 L
cd /usr/local/src/e2fsprogs-1.42.7; {: X; o! T! q% ~) K5 k B
mkdir build+ J5 b2 [# S, _8 d. H: R- y+ e/ t" J8 n
cd build
6 t& C5 Y2 z5 c ../configure b7 m( K `& x- }1 B4 h
make
! D3 x( k3 D. c* @' A9 G9 b make install
1 }6 {! c$ v) L8 C0 V' Z! dmke2fs -O 64bit,has_journal,extents,huge_file,flex_bg,uninit_bg,dir_nlink,extra_isize -i 4194304 /dev/sdb1
Q- T3 x' G0 h2 V% k; x憿舐內銝:2 s& R5 g4 V3 p" p: p& f! L% B
This filesystem will be automatically checked every 27 mounts or% t" |/ U: F! t% \/ c$ [8 y4 R
180 days, whichever comes first. Use tune2fs -c or -i to override.
1 V" [# z( J7 [3 e/etc/fstab銝剖乩 : (fstab隞蝝:http://horace1123.pixnet.net/blo ... b%E8%AA%AA%E6%98%8E)0 y/ s; O6 E& `' d
/dev/sdb1 /home2 ext4 defaults 1 0(蝚砌詨1:瘥亙隞,蝚砌詨0:蝟餌絞銝甇撣豢fsck銝瑼X)/ p5 H& d% w) [; j* X9 v/ @
mount /home2' X/ R; B, o3 V# |9 R6 K7 {
7 Z0 L' m, H+ w* ?/ s, x
4 y& U1 o7 p& a. Z( N( f! e2 c( Y=======================================================================0 f$ R: Q8 i% e2 t
' Q! L: V. E+ O, i, V. w, _
[蝖祉皜祈岫]1.
3 y" W6 |0 R+ Q* A' HLinux蝖祉撖怠仿摨行葫閰衣隞:
& i# h" ?) Y5 o) M0 t5 w& s2 F#time dd if=/dev/zero of=/home2/test bs=2k count=1000000 // /home2 痂ount raid0 33TB 蝖祉, 11*3TB銋SCSI蝖祉" ?2 D; C$ q9 b
1000000+0 records in6 W. i6 h$ {4 ]5 D( U
1000000+0 records out0 i; x- H3 T+ Y, {2 W: h
2048000000 bytes (2.0 GB) copied, 3.58735 s, 571 MB/s
% j8 x& O, z d" q9 ^5 o0 ^3 a
real 0m3.590s
( K! {, t: P% d4 g% Ruser 0m0.130s
# @) V \7 t; o" H8 p0 csys 0m3.455s
( {) D- `/ {" [$ x: u) H0 u; K+ i3 N0 ?$ B+ {0 z7 T
9 A8 w$ a+ s% T7 g Q3 GLinux蝖祉霈摨行葫閰衣隞:
- n6 N. R" Z) P' n* B! S& J#time dd if=/home2/test of=/dev/null bs=2k* S0 B9 C$ z( s5 |' ~7 _
1000000+0 records in6 i% ^& h! v: L
1000000+0 records out
$ t$ e i I* C R( S2048000000 bytes (2.0 GB) copied, 0.952334 s, 2.2 GB/s) q( F; b. I, B) x
3 |& M; ?- c! D1 F9 j& U6 Ireal 0m0.954s
% }* ?" D+ F6 e8 n( s6 yuser 0m0.083s4 g) z7 L( S6 X2 N1 W3 I, l3 f
sys 0m0.868s. D3 [& P8 q, e/ Z0 J
& P1 y* ^, Q; }, R3 s: i/ w閫嚗
+ k- j" a2 D% G' q6 rtime 其閮
" F" i! ]7 ~ H5 s0 }, W, m$ @5 tdd 其銴鋆踝敺if OF+ J: M" H( c0 d" i4 ^: T/ N+ b
if=/dev/zero銝YIO嚗隞亙臭誑其皜祈岫蝝蝎孵神摨;璅 of=/dev/null 銝YIO嚗臭誑其皜祈岫蝝蝎寡摨3 y/ K0 ?% m( C/ c2 Q
bs 舀甈⊥葫閰血桐憭批嚗count航撖怎嚗訾撠望航憭批.
- }9 n8 k9 P/ c. E' B鞈頞憭扯皞蝣綽憭皜祈岫靘撟喳潦$ S. `9 j6 ], x" K/ X
豢頞憭扯蝖殷憭甈⊥葫閰血撟喳/ F5 L% y! }: q
望葫閰衣敺啁豢憿舐內摨衣貊嗅翰鈭3 x* y9 N/ F- u8 V
! I1 [" r$ K; e
皜祈岫摰閮敺芷 /home2/test
* @8 ~9 Z' {9 _$ ~2 \. s2.
Z2 q( y$ b7 e+ N+ N虫蝔格寞:! p( h- m. a; W _0 ?1 L% |! H6 T
; q, }- F! v6 j4 \8 |
皜祈岫蝖祉霈摨:
2 I& d9 E& ~, h% }- N5 u, Fhdparm -t /dev/sdb+ Y% \2 Q7 U& r6 r5 D$ o
2 S: c1 @1 f. k2 \" r$ e/dev/sdb: (雿輻禿aid0摨血翰)
5 {) z0 i, x% r' d/ N2 I; q Timing buffered disk reads: 1732 MB in 3.00 seconds = 576.98 MB/sec4 a2 I- ~* i( z |0 A
/ A! Z3 j5 W4 j( t3 q0 |
/dev/sdb: (敺靘寞LVM摨行)" j) W6 {1 C2 j! y# y9 k
/dev/sdb:
' Z! x: m. J- [+ d0 B0 qTiming buffered disk reads: 546 MB in 3.01 seconds = 181.43 MB/sec" I) u% `! i% \/ J5 e
皜祈岫蝖祉撖怠仿摨:" _+ q; l8 a6 O3 h2 ]6 d) ^! V& i
hdparm -t --direct /dev/sdb
. `# G; C$ y _9 F
8 l5 _& |: u1 c, K0 q1 y/ Q/dev/sdb: (雿輻禿aid0摨血翰)
) g0 r: I/ d, F" \# H" O( ^ Timing O_DIRECT disk reads: 1326 MB in 3.29 seconds = 402.57 MB/sec
; `% Q; h6 d1 R8 h1 d2 B+ u9 D" H# o' m& B! Y
/dev/sdb: (敺靘寞LVM摨行)
0 z) r2 g- e9 c0 v2 k( Y8 S Timing O_DIRECT disk reads: 560 MB in 3.00 seconds = 186.36 MB/sec6 f" W. m! x4 x6 ]- ]* q9 | k& a" C
3 ]' X6 [; Y4 o" N5 x% i* j; t, h/ p$ |5 @) L+ g! y/ E
血皜祈岫 /dev/sda SSD蝖祉 摨血芣 raid0 scsi 蝖祉銝8 I4 D" R% i: g. F' {) N) N
, f1 P- g* \7 `: B$ {) Z/ I
* r1 Q( p2 g8 }6 p( B
' }% n' P: @- l: r
+ n, T5 p+ a' J5 e" g! ]" W0 A1 Q5 V- p$ b' K- Q/ \
! Q/ T% o( y! B' R3 W. y$ X
|
|